How much do gaming associate jobs pay per hour?

As of Aug 12, 2026, the average hourly pay for gaming associate in Houston, TX is $19.63, according to ZipRecruiter salary data. Most workers in this role earn between $16.06 and $23.65 per hour, depending on experience, location, and employer.

What does a gaming associate do?

Gaming associates are employed by casinos to provide customer service and general operations support. The duties of a gaming associate may include greeting guests and answering any questions they may have about the casino or specific games. Gaming associates also help oversee operations on the floor, ensuring that dealers are collecting bets handling money per the supervisor’s guidelines. A gaming associate needs strong interpersonal, communication and math skills. Most entry-level positions require a high school diploma and provide on-the-job training.

What are some common challenges gaming associates face during busy shifts, and how can they effectively manage them?

Gaming Associates often encounter high-pressure situations during peak hours, such as managing large crowds, handling disputes between players, and ensuring strict compliance with gaming regulations. Effective communication, maintaining a calm demeanor, and strong multitasking abilities are key to successfully navigating these challenges. Many Gaming Associates find that developing a solid understanding of game rules and procedures, along with ongoing training, helps them remain efficient and provide excellent customer service even during the busiest times.

What are the key skills and qualifications needed to thrive as a gaming associate, and why are they important?

To thrive as a Gaming Associate, you need strong customer service skills, attention to detail, and a high school diploma or equivalent, with gaming licenses often required by regulatory bodies. Familiarity with point-of-sale (POS) systems, surveillance equipment, and casino management software is typically necessary. Excellent communication, integrity, and the ability to remain calm under pressure help build trust with patrons and colleagues. These skills are critical for ensuring regulatory compliance, maintaining a positive gaming environment, and delivering exceptional guest experiences.

What is a gaming associate?

Gaming Associates are professionals who assist in the operation of casino games and gaming tables, ensuring that games run smoothly and players follow the rules. They may handle chips, monitor gameplay, and provide customer service to guests. Their responsibilities can also include reporting suspicious activities, explaining game rules to players, and maintaining a fair and enjoyable gaming environment. Gaming Associates work under the supervision of gaming supervisors and are often employed in casinos, racetracks, or other gaming establishments.

Position Summary:  

Puttshack is looking to attract a diverse team of fun hospitality associates who care deeply about creating an elevated, one-of-a-kind guest experience. The Game Ambassador position is responsible for greeting guests with a warm welcome on the courses, checking in reservations, and guiding the guest safely throughout the course for an exciting Puttshack game experience. The Game Ambassador is the champion of our technology infused mini-golf game and is responsible for explaining the rules of the game, answering any questions, and troubleshooting any issues throughout the guests’ gaming experience.

Schedule/Hours:

Our venues are open 7 days/week, typically from 11am-1am with some variations. While we will do our best to accommodate scheduling preferences, they may not always be guaranteed, and we value flexibility. All positions within our venue are variable schedules, meaning a typical schedule may be anywhere between 15 and 30 hours on a weekly basis depending on business needs and individual availability.
